Chinese medicine is an ancient practice that has been used for centuries to heal the body. While the practice is a powerful tool for promoting wellness, we can’t forget to also pay attention to the products we use in our everyday lives. This Tiktoker shares everyday products that she no longer buys after becoming a doctoral student studying Chinese medicine.

Toxic ingredients can often be hiding in some of the most common household items, such as laundry detergent, candles, and cooking oils.

Laundry detergent can contain petroleum, phthalates, phosphates, chlorine, optical brighteners, synthetic fragrances, and dyes, which can cause skin irritation and may even be carcinogenic. Check out 10 Eco-Friendly Detergents Easy On Your Skin and the Environment!

Many synthetic fragrances in candles also contain phthalates, which are a group of chemicals used to make plastics more durable. As candles burn, phthalates are released into the air and can be inhaled or absorbed through the skin, and ultimately enter the bloodstream. Instead of buying artificially-scented candles, consider making your own natural candle, or diffusing essential oils.

Most people use cooking oil in all sorts of dishes, but don’t know that some can actually be toxic! Canola oil for example is often extracted using chemical solvents such as hexane, which can leave residues in the oil and enter your body. Luckily, there are plenty of healthier alternatives to choose from.
